Output ebbcaf37951db4cbc71bee72d124dbf0ea266cb62f20ebc5307c03d7cc33e2b6:0

value
298849554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d5dd7bfba5f48e66bc8d7cc2db87b779d19b5b5 OP_EQUAL
address
3LQtsBL6supEh3nzWbDQi2cEcGTvBLG7vj
transaction
ebbcaf37951db4cbc71bee72d124dbf0ea266cb62f20ebc5307c03d7cc33e2b6
confirmations
155798
spent
true